Could Tucson Break the Heat Record?

Last updated 10 months ago

"Tucson could still be on its way toward breaking a heat record - even after a recent spell of relatively cool weather.

The record in question is for the number of days when temperatures have hit or topped 100 sizzling degrees in a single year. The current record, set in 1994, is 99 days.

Last week, the city pulled slightly ahead of the 1994 pace for triple-digit days by this time of year - making it possible to rack up a total of 100 or more such days by the end of the hot season."
